What is Choroidal Melanoma?
Choroidal melanoma is the most common primary cancer of the eye in adults. It arises from the pigment cells in the choroid layer.
How is Choroidal Melanoma treated?
Treatment options include Plaque Brachytherapy (Radiation), Enucleation (Removal of eye), Laser Therapy. The best approach depends on your specific diagnosis, severity, and lifestyle needs.
